Pressure-Treated Lumber: The Protector
Think of pressure-treated lumber as the knight in shining armor of the wood world. It’s been specially treated to resist rot and insects. That’s a big win when your swing set lives outdoors!
- Pros: Super durable, resists rot and bugs like a champ, relatively affordable.
- Cons: Historically, chemical treatments have raised environmental and health concerns. While modern pressure-treated lumber is safer, it’s still good to be aware. Always check the label for the type of treatment used.
- Handling Precautions: Wear gloves and a mask when cutting or sanding. Don’t burn treated wood. Dispose of scraps properly according to local regulations.
Cedar and Redwood: The Natural Beauties
Cedar and redwood are the cool kids of the lumberyard. They have a natural resistance to rot and insects, plus they look amazing. That reddish hue? Chef’s kiss!
- Pros: Natural rot resistance, beautiful color and grain, less likely to splinter than some other woods.
- Cons: Can be more expensive than pressure-treated lumber. Sustainability is a factor, so look for wood that is certified by the Forest Stewardship Council (FSC).
Pine: The Budget-Friendly Option
Pine is like the reliable friend who’s always there for you (and your wallet). It’s affordable and easy to work with, but it needs some TLC to survive the elements.
- Pros: Affordable, readily available, easy to cut and shape.
- Cons: Needs to be treated to resist rot and insects. Requires regular maintenance.
- Treatment Options: Use a high-quality exterior wood preservative, stain, or paint. Reapply every year or two to keep it protected.
Oak: The Strong One
Oak is like the bodybuilder of the wood family. It’s incredibly strong and durable, making it perfect for load-bearing parts of your swing set.
- Pros: Exceptionally strong and durable, ideal for legs and header beams.
- Cons: More expensive than other options, heavy and harder to work with.

Bolts and Screws: Know Your Weaponry!
Think of bolts and screws as the bread and butter of swing set construction. They might seem interchangeable, but they each have their own superpower.
- Bolts are the heavy hitters. They’re designed for strength and are best used when you’re clamping two or more pieces of wood together. Always pair them with washers and nuts for maximum holding power.
- Screws, on the other hand, are great for joining wood more directly. Self-tapping screws can even create their own threads as you drive them in. When choosing screws, think about the size, length and material. For outdoor use, always go for galvanized or coated screws to avoid the dreaded rust monster.
Washers and Nuts: The Dynamic Duo!
These guys are like the Robin to Batman – essential for the mission.
- Washers are those flat, disc-shaped heroes that prevent the bolt head or nut from digging into the wood. They spread the pressure, reducing the chance of wood compression and keeping everything nice and snug.
- Nuts come in different flavors too! Standard nuts are great, but if you want extra security, lock nuts (with nylon inserts) are your best friend. They resist loosening, even with all that swinging action!
Lag Screws and Carriage Bolts: The Big Guns!
When you need a connection that can handle some serious weight, it’s time to bring out the big guns.
- Lag screws are like giant screws with a bolt head, perfect for attaching hefty components such as legs to the header beam. Just drill a pilot hole first to make installation easier.
- Carriage bolts have a smooth, rounded head and a square shoulder that locks into the wood, preventing them from turning as you tighten the nut. These are awesome for a clean, secure look on exposed surfaces.
Metal Plates and Brackets: The Reinforcements!
Think of these as the body armor for your swing set joints. Metal plates and brackets provide extra reinforcement, especially at corners and points where stress is concentrated (like where the A-frame legs meet). They come in various shapes and sizes, so choose wisely based on the joint you’re fortifying.
Chains, S-Hooks, and Quick Links: The Swing Team!
These are your direct connection to the joy of swinging, so quality is key.
- Make sure your chains are weight-rated to handle more than what you expect, this is for safety!
- S-hooks and quick links should also be heavy-duty and easy to open and close, but secure enough to stay put during all that swinging, twisting, and laughing. And always, always inspect them regularly for wear and tear!
Sealants, Stains, Paint, and Wood Preservatives: The Guardians of the Wood
These aren’t just for aesthetics, they’re crucial for protecting your swing set from the elements.
- Caulking around joints acts like a shield, preventing water from sneaking in and causing wood rot. Nobody wants a soggy swing set!
- Stains and paint do more than just add color; they protect the wood from harmful UV rays, which can cause it to fade and crack over time.
- Wood preservatives are like a deep-conditioning treatment for your lumber. They penetrate the wood fibers to prevent rot and insect damage, especially important for any parts that come into contact with the ground.

Butt Joint: The Simple Starter
The butt joint is the simplest kid on the block—it’s just two pieces of wood butted up against each other. While easy to create, it’s not exactly the strongest on its own. Think of it as a handshake—nice for a greeting, but not sturdy enough to hold a heavy load. To make it work for a swing set, you’ll definitely need some reinforcement, like metal plates or plenty of screws. Best to reserve this one for non-load-bearing connections, like attaching decorative trim.
Lap Joint: The Overlapping Champ
The lap joint is like giving your handshake a bit more oomph by overlapping the wood. This gives you more surface area for glue and fasteners, making it significantly stronger than a butt joint. It’s also super easy to create, making it a great option for many swing set connections where you need a bit more security, such as attaching support pieces.
Mortise and Tenon Joint: The Timeless Classic
Now we’re talking serious strength! The mortise and tenon joint is a classic for a reason. It involves fitting a ‘tongue’ (the tenon) into a ‘hole’ (the mortise). This creates an exceptionally strong and stable connection, perfect for load-bearing joints like where the A-frame legs meet the top beam. The downside? It’s more complex to make, requiring precision and some woodworking skill.
Dowel Joint: The Alignment Ally
The dowel joint uses small wooden pegs (dowels) to provide alignment and added strength to a joint. It’s like adding extra pins to hold things together! While not as strong as a mortise and tenon, it’s great for connecting rails and other non-critical components, where you need a clean look and a bit of extra stability.
Bridle Joint: The Racking Resister
Think of the bridle joint as the mortise and tenon’s beefier cousin. It’s a variation that offers even greater strength and, crucially, resistance to racking (that wobbly side-to-side movement you definitely don’t want in a swing set!). This joint is excellent where extra stability is paramount.
Half-Lap Joint: The Flush Finisher
When you need a strong connection that sits flush, the half-lap joint is your go-to. It involves removing half the thickness of each piece of wood where they overlap, so the finished joint is level. It looks neater than a regular lap joint and is perfect for situations where you want a clean, professional finish without sacrificing strength.

Measuring Tools: Accuracy is Your Superpower
Forget the saying, “measure twice, cut once.” When building a swing set, measure thrice, just to be safe. A tape measure is your trusty sidekick for overall dimensions, but don’t underestimate the power of a good ruler for smaller, more precise measurements. A level ensures your swing set stands straight and true, preventing any embarrassing (and dangerous) wobbles. And lastly, a square helps you create perfect 90-degree angles, essential for solid joints. Remember, a swing set is only as good as its angles!
Cutting Tools: Sawing Through the Confusion
Ah, the saws! This is where the fun (and potential for sawdust) really begins. A hand saw is great for smaller cuts or when you want a more controlled approach. A circular saw is your go-to for long, straight cuts on larger pieces of lumber. A miter saw is your secret weapon for angled cuts, perfect for those A-frame legs. Always remember safety glasses and a steady hand. Each saw has advantages and disadvantages, and which one to use depends on the type of cut you’re making and the accuracy needed.
Safety Tip: No matter what saw you’re using, always make sure your material is properly secured and your fingers are out of the path of the blade.
Drilling Tools: Making Holes with Purpose
A drill is like a magic wand that creates holes exactly where you need them. But it’s only as good as its bits! Use a drill bit slightly smaller than your screw size to prevent splitting the wood. When drilling, start slowly and apply steady pressure. For larger holes, consider using a spade bit or hole saw.
Pro Tip: To prevent tear-out on the backside of your hole, place a scrap piece of wood behind your workpiece while drilling.
Fastening Tools: Holding it All Together
Now, let’s get this swing set bolted, screwed, and locked together for long term! From simple screws and bolts, to nuts and washers, these are your must-have tools when it comes to fastening. Make sure that you know the size, shape, and material to ensure a tight and durable hold. You might have a regular screwdriver lying around, but trust us, an impact driver will be your new best friend. It makes driving screws a breeze, especially when working with tougher woods.
Clamping Tools: The Unsung Heroes
Clamps are like extra sets of hands, holding pieces firmly in place while glue dries or you drive in fasteners. Use pipe clamps for larger assemblies and quick-grip clamps for smaller tasks. Don’t underestimate the power of a good vise for holding smaller pieces while you work on them.
Safety Gear: Your Personal Armor
And finally, the most important tools of all: your safety gear. Always wear safety glasses to protect your eyes from flying debris. Gloves protect your hands from splinters and rough edges. And ear protection will save your hearing from the deafening roar of power tools. Safety is not optional, it’s essential!

A-Frame: The Backbone of Fun
The A-frame isn’t just a cool shape; it’s the primary support of your whole operation. This baby takes the brunt of all the swinging, climbing, and general kid-powered chaos. That’s why solid joinery here isn’t just recommended, it’s essential. Think of it as the foundation of your fun factory.
- Joinery Options: Angled lap joints are your best friend here. They give you a nice, broad surface for gluing and screwing, spreading the load effectively. But don’t stop there! Reinforce those joints with metal plates. Trust me, a little extra metal goes a long way in preventing wobbles and worries.
Top Beam/Header: The Load-Bearing Champion
This is where the swings actually hang, so it needs to be seriously strong. This connects the A-frame legs and carries all the weight so, it is very important! We’re talking mortise and tenon joints if you’re feeling fancy and want ultimate strength. These joints are classic for a reason – they’re practically bombproof when done right.
- Joinery Options: If mortise and tenon feels too advanced, reinforced lap joints are a totally acceptable alternative. Again, metal plates can be your savior, adding that extra bit of security.
Legs: Grounded and Glorious
The legs need to be firmly attached to that header beam. We want them securely attached to provide sturdy standing! Think about how you want your swing to be sturdy and not give out from under your kids.
- Joinery Options: Lag screws or carriage bolts are your go-to guys here. Drill pilot holes to prevent splitting, and make sure those bolts are TIGHT. Proper alignment and leveling are also crucial. Nobody wants a swing set that leans like it’s had one too many.
Swing Hangers: Where the Magic Happens
Attaching those swing hangers is where the rubber meets the road, or rather, where the chain meets the wood. Proper spacing is vital to avoid mid-air collisions and general chaos.
- Joinery Options: Use hangers specifically designed for swing sets, and make sure they’re properly weight-rated. Bolt them securely through the header beam. Double-check everything, then triple-check it. This is no place for guesswork.
Seats: Bottoms Up!
How you attach the seats depends on whether you’re using chains or ropes. Either way, the goal is the same: maximum security.
- Joinery Options: For chains, use S-hooks and quick links, ensuring they’re heavy-duty and properly closed. For ropes, use knots that are specifically designed for holding weight and won’t slip.
Ladders/Climbing Structures: Adding to the Adventure
Ladders and climbing structures add another layer of fun (and complexity) to your swing set. You want these elements to be rock solid.
- Joinery Options: Dowel joints or lap joints work well for connecting the rungs to the side supports. Make sure everything is glued and screwed for extra stability.
Braces: The Unsung Heroes
Braces might seem like an afterthought, but they’re essential for stability and rigidity. Think of them as the support system for your support system.
- Joinery Options: Angled braces attached with lap joints and screws will do the trick. These guys help prevent the whole structure from wobbling and swaying, keeping things safe and sound.

Load Capacity: Know Your Limits!
Think of your swing set like a bridge. It’s got a limit to how much weight it can handle. Ignoring this is like playing a game of chance, but the stakes are too high for a kid’s play. Check the manufacturer’s specifications for weight limits on every part of your swing set. And err on the side of caution. If the swings say 150 pounds each, don’t let your 160-pound buddy hop on unless you want to see some serious structural strain or at worst, an avoidable injury. Over-engineering is your friend here. Adding extra support never hurts.
Safety Standards: The Rules of the Game
Did you know there are actual rules about how swing sets should be built? They’re there for a reason. Researching and following guidelines from organizations like the Consumer Product Safety Commission (CPSC) will give you peace of mind. These standards cover everything from swing spacing to fall zones and are designed to prevent injuries. Do some digging online; it is worth it!
Spacing: Give ‘Em Some Elbow Room
Ever been on a crowded dance floor? Now imagine that, but with swings flying at high speeds. Not fun! Ensure enough space between swings and other structures to prevent mid-air collisions. The recommended spacing varies, but a good rule of thumb is to have at least 24 inches between swings and any nearby object.
Ground Anchoring: Stay Grounded!
A swing set is no good if it tips over. Anchor that bad boy to the ground. You can use ground anchors, concrete footings, or even just burying the legs partially in the ground. The key is to make sure it’s stable, especially if you have enthusiastic little swingers or live in a windy area. If you don’t properly ground the swing set, you are basically inviting trouble in.
Weather Resistance: Fight the Elements
Sun, rain, snow – Mother Nature can be brutal. Protect your wood with sealants, stains, and paints specifically designed for outdoor use. These act like sunscreen for your swing set, preventing rot, warping, and fading. Reapply every year or two, or as needed, especially if you live in an area with extreme weather conditions.
Maintenance: An Ounce of Prevention
Regular checkups are key to keeping your swing set safe. Make it a habit to inspect it at least twice a year. Look for:
- Loose bolts or screws.
- Cracked or warped wood.
- Rusty hardware.
- Worn swing connections.
Tighten, repair, or replace anything that looks questionable. A little maintenance can prevent a big disaster.
Structural Integrity: Strength in Numbers
Check for any signs of sagging, leaning, or twisting. These could indicate a problem with the underlying structure or joint failures. Ensure that all joints are still secure and properly connected. If any part of the frame seems unstable, reinforce it immediately.
Corrosion Resistance: Rust Never Sleeps
Rust is the enemy of metal hardware. Always use galvanized or stainless-steel hardware, which is designed to resist corrosion. Inspect metal parts regularly for any signs of rust, and replace them if necessary. A little bit of prevention here can make all the difference.
Wood Rot: The Silent Killer
Wood rot is a sneaky destroyer. Regularly inspect wood, especially in areas that are exposed to moisture. Look for signs of decay, like softness or discoloration. If you find rot, replace the affected wood immediately. Applying wood preservatives can help to prevent future rot.
Joint Strength: The Heart of the Matter
Joints are where the rubber meets the road in terms of strength and stability. Ensure that all joints are still strong and secure. Check for any signs of separation, cracking, or movement. Reinforce any questionable joints with additional hardware or by adding braces.
Playground Safety: The Big Picture
Consider the entire play area around the swing set. Make sure there’s a soft landing surface, like wood chips, sand, or rubber mulch, extending at least 6 feet in all directions from the swings. Keep the area free of obstacles, like rocks, roots, and sharp objects.
